How Our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Process Works
Bathroom water damage restoration is a complex process that needs specialized equipment and expertise. Our team follows a step-by-step protocol to ensure that every job is done right the first time. Here’s an overview of what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ives quickly and assesses the damage to find out the best course of action. We contain the affected area to prevent further damage and prevent cross-contamination. This includes removing any wet materials and setting up indust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ry out the area.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use powerful extractors to remove standing water from the affected area. This includes removing wet flooring and draining flooded are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out the affected area. This includes monitoring moisture levels to ensure that the area is completely dry.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es removing any affected materials and disinfecting surfaces.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that the job is done right. We make any necessary touch-ups to ensure that the area is completely dry and free of any damage.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Dunedin, FL
The cost of bathroom water damage restoration in Dunedin,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common bathroom water damage restoration services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Containment and cleaning |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Disinfection and deodorization |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Reconstruction and renovation |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
